随着企业APP各个功能模块中信息量的逐渐增加,如何利用关键词快速查找所需信息已成为APP要解决的关键问题之一。对于小型企业APP,由于数据量不是太大,因此使用基于数据库的模糊检索方法可以满足要求。但
是,这种检索方法仅适用于检索结构化数据,而不能检索文本和图片等非结构化数据。此外,在使用类似查询时,您需要一次检索数据库表中的所有相关字段。在大量数据环境中,类似查询会对系统性能产生重大影响。
为了解决传统数据检索方法效率低的问题,以Lucene为代表的站内全文检索技术应运而生。Lucene的检索过程实际上是将模糊查询变成可以使用索引的准确查询的过程。就像查字典一样。您只需从索引目录中找到
所需字符的页码即可实现精确定位。页面的搜索大大提高了数据检索的效率和准确性。全文检索的实现主要分为两个步骤,索引创建和搜索索引。其中,索引创建是提取结构化数据和非结构化数据的特征信息,并将其存储在创
建的索引数据库中。搜索索引是根据用户需要的关键字从索引数据库中查找满足条件的记录,然后将查询结果返回给用户。
摄影摄像行业廊坊APP开发案例廊坊金夫人婚纱摄影公司廊坊APP开发妆面页面效果图